本题的难点在于输出结果的形式
import java.util.Scanner;
public class Main {
public static void main(String[] args) {
Scanner sc = new Scanner(System.in);
int r = sc.nextInt();
double area = Math.PI * r * r;
System.out.println(String.format("%.7f", area));//保留小数点后七位
sc.close();
}
}